Built a 1000 sq ft garage (approx 28x36) with 10’ walls and vaulted ceilings (14’ at peak). R15 in 2x4 walls and insulated garage door, etc. The 6” slab has 4 loops of about 200’ each of 1/2” pex.
My question...planning to buy an electric tankless unit (ecosmart 24/27) along with a small pump and possibly a expansion tank, then use a small Timer to heat the floor a few times daily, running in closed loop.
Live in Kansas, it gets to about +15* most nights in winter.
This is an hobby garage, I get out there most evenings for a few hours but happy with 50-55*, don’t care about 75* temps.
So, any huge red flags with my plan?
PS—plan B is to do a simple 20 gallon electric tank, seems this may simplify the pressure related challenges in a tankless system. Thoughts??
